USAGE SUMMARY

The phrase 'our main objective' is correct and usable in written English.
You can use it to describe the overall goal of a plan or project. For example: "Our main objective is to increase customer satisfaction by 15% over the next six months."

FAQs

What are some alternatives to "our main objective"?

You can use alternatives like "our primary goal", "our principal aim", or "our chief purpose" depending on the context.

How can I use "our main objective" in a sentence?

You can start a sentence with "Our main objective is..." followed by a clear and specific statement of your goal. For example, "Our main objective is to increase sales by 20% this quarter."

What's the difference between "our main objective" and "our mission statement"?

While both define direction, "our main objective" is a specific, achievable goal, whereas a mission statement is a broader declaration of purpose. Think of the former as a target and the latter as a guiding philosophy.

Is it grammatically correct to say "our main objectives are" instead of "our main objective is"?

Yes, it is grammatically correct. Use "our main objective is" when referring to a single goal. Use "our main objectives are" when referring to multiple goals.
